Trump Account for Kids: Navigating a Complex Digital Landscape

The digital world presents unique challenges for parents, especially when it comes to exposing children to political figures and potentially divisive content. The question of a “Trump account for kids” – whether through official channels or simply children encountering content *about* Donald Trump online – is becoming increasingly relevant. This guide aims to provide parents with a balanced perspective, outlining the potential benefits, risks, and how to navigate this complex landscape.

The Risks: Why Caution is Advised

The risks associated with a “Trump account for kids” or even general exposure to politically charged content are significant:

  • Exposure to Misinformation: The online environment is rife with misinformation and biased reporting. Children are particularly vulnerable to believing false narratives.
  • Polarization and Division: Exposure to highly partisan content can contribute to polarization and division, potentially shaping children’s views in a way that hinders constructive dialogue.
  • Inappropriate Language and Behavior: Donald Trump’s public persona has often been characterized by controversial language and behavior. Exposure to this content may be unsuitable for children.
  • Emotional Distress: Political discussions can be emotionally charged. Children may experience anxiety or distress when exposed to negative or upsetting content.

Parental Guidance: How to Navigate This

If your child encounters content related to Donald Trump online, here are some tips for navigating the situation:

  • Open Communication: Talk to your child about what they’re seeing and hearing. Encourage them to ask questions and express their feelings.
  • Fact-Checking: Teach your child the importance of fact-checking and verifying information from multiple sources. Snopes is a reliable fact-checking resource.
  • Contextualization: Provide context for the information your child is encountering. Explain the different perspectives and biases that may be present.
  • Age-Appropriateness: Be mindful of your child’s age and maturity level. Avoid exposing them to content that is too complex or emotionally challenging.
  • Monitor Online Activity: Keep an eye on your child’s online activity and be aware of the websites and platforms they are using.
